Lenovo rose 52 spots to No. 196 on Fortune magazine’s annual Global 500 list, ranking No. 13 among companies featured in the technology sector. This achievement marks Lenovo’s 16th year on the Global 500, highlighting the company as one of the world’s 500 largest companies by revenue and its highest ranking ever in the technology sector. This rise in the rankings reflects Lenovo’s strong annual revenue in 2024/25, with revenue on an ex-HKG basis increasing by 21% year-on-year to USD 69.1 billion and net profit increasing by 36% to USD 1.4 billion, the second highest in the company’s history.
Lenovo’s outstanding performance was driven not only by its focus on executing a clearly diversified growth strategy, but also by its end-to-end integrated global operations, ODM+ manufacturing model, and global resource/local delivery model. Over the past 20 years of global business operations, Lenovo has established a manufacturing footprint that boasts more than 30 manufacturing locations (in-house or outsourced) in 11 different markets around the world. Together, these will give Lenovo maximum flexibility and resilience, enabling it to navigate uncertainties and better adapt to macro market conditions.
Additionally, Lenovo continues to prioritize investment in innovation, with R&D spending increasing 13% year over year in the last fiscal year. This initiative drives an important milestone in the company’s hybrid AI strategy and strengthens the company’s focus and readiness for the Decade of AI.
Lenovo plans to report its first quarter 2025/26 results on August 14, 2025.
